Follow these 10 easy steps to send your partner some happy washi mail:

  • Step 1: Read your partner's profile.
  • Step 2: Choose 4 washi tapes from your tape stash you think will make your partner happy, and "wrap up 18-inch samples of each tape".
  • Step 3: Using those same tape designs, make your partner a washi note card.
  • Step 4: Write a note to your partner inside this washi note card. Tell a little about you and your day. Perhaps you'll write what you like about autumn. Feel free to write anything you want - my main point here is to write more than just "hi, here is the swap." :)
  • Step 5: Put the 4 washi tape samples into the note card.
  • Step 6: Put the note card into an envelope.
  • Step 7: Address the envelope to your partner and add your return address too.
  • Step 8: Put proper postage on your envelope.
  • Step 9: Decorate your envelope with, what else? TAPE :)
  • Step 10: Send this happy washi mail to your partner.

Note: Feel free to do Step 9, then Step 7, then Step 8. (See @user2637 s comment at the swap site, and my comment.)
